What Is IELTS?
IELTS is a standardised test created to evaluate the English language efficiency of non‑native speakers. It is collectively handled by the British Council, IDP: IELTS Australia, and Cambridge Assessment English. The exam is available in two formats: Academic (for university admission) and General Training (for immigration and work environment functions). Both formats evaluate the exact same 4 language abilities-- listening, reading, writing, and speaking-- but differ in the material and context of the tasks.

Scoring and Band Descriptors
IELTS utilizes a 9‑band scoring system, where each band represents a level of English proficiency. The overall band score is the average of the four part ratings, rounded to the nearby whole or half band.
Band ScoreProficiency Level9Specialist User-- totally functional command of the language.8Really Good User-- completely functional command with periodic errors.7Excellent User-- operational command with occasional misunderstandings.6Qualified User-- efficient command in spite of some inaccuracies.5Modest User-- partial command, frequent issues.4Limited User-- limited command, frequent breakdowns.3Incredibly Limited User-- can convey just basic meaning.2Periodic User-- terrific difficulty understanding spoken English.1Non‑User-- no ability to utilize the language.
The majority of universities and migration authorities set a minimum requirement of Band 6 or 6.5, while more competitive programs may ask for Band 7 or higher.

How long does it require to receive the IELTS certificate?
Results are launched 13 days after the test date for paper‑based exams and 5‑7 days for computer‑delivered tests. The Test Report Form (TRF) can be downloaded right away or sent to institutions electronically.
2. Can I retake only one component of the test?
No. IELTS scores are based upon all 4 elements taken together. If you want to improve a particular band, you need to retake the entire exam.
3. What is the minimum score needed for immigration?
Requirements differ by nation and visa classification. For example, Canada's Express Entry system typically demands a minimum of CLB 7, which corresponds to IELTS Band 6 in each component.
4. Is the IELTS certificate accepted for UK visa applications?
Yes. The UK Home Office accepts IELTS for a number of visa tiers, including the Short‑Term Study Visa and Skilled Worker Visa. The test needs to be taken at an approved centre.
5. Can I utilize the IELTS certificate for several applications?
Yes. The TRF can be sent to a limitless number of institutions; nevertheless, each recipient should request the score electronically or receive a printed copy.
6. What takes place if I are unhealthy on the test day?
If you have a medical condition, get in touch with the test centre as quickly as possible. Some centres provide a medical deferral, permitting you to reschedule without charge.
7. Exist any age constraints for taking IELTS?
There is no main age limit; however, candidates under 16 are discouraged unless needed for particular scholastic programs.
